I have a Casio LK-230. I'm not an expert but I do know how to play piano and this is my first real keyboard cause I got it pretty cheap. My question is in the instruction booklet that came with my keyboard it says that I can change octaves on the board itself. Basically move middle C up an octave on the keys so that I can play lower notes on the keyboard. The instruction manual however does not explain how to do this. Does anyone know how to do this or if it's even possible. It would suck if it's not possible cause then I can't play a lot of low octave songs that I like. The instruction manual gives C2-C7 as the normal range, C3-C8 as high pitch, and C1-C6 as low pitch. I want to get to the low pitch. Thanks.
